Indulge in the vibrant layers of Khanom Chan, a traditional Thai dessert made with fragrant pandan and creamy coconut milk. Perfect for special occasions or a sweet treat to share with loved ones.
IngredientsWhat you need
- 1 cup rice flour
- 1 cup tapioca flour
- 1 cup coconut milk
- 1 cup palm sugar
- 1/2 cup water
- 1 teaspoon pandan extract
- 1 teaspoon salt
Method
- 1
In a mixing bowl, combine rice flour, tapioca flour, and salt. Mix well to combine.
- 2
In a small saucepan, heat the coconut milk, palm sugar, and water over medium heat until the sugar is dissolved. Remove from heat.
- 3
Gradually add the coconut mixture to the flour mixture, stirring continuously until smooth.
- 4
Divide the mixture into two bowls. Add pandan extract to one bowl and mix well. Leave the other bowl plain.
- 5
Prepare a steamer. Pour a layer of the plain mixture into a greased tray and steam for about 10 minutes until set.
- 6
Pour a layer of the pandan mixture over the plain layer and steam for another 10 minutes. Repeat the layers until all mixtures are used.
- 7
Let the Khanom Chan cool completely before slicing into pieces.
- 8
Serve at room temperature and enjoy your traditional Thai dessert.
